Job Description: 

 

The Packaging Operator is responsible for inspecting and packaging various shapes of metal preforms or stampings into designated containers according to customer requirements. This role requires careful attention to detail, adherence to safety and quality standards, and accurate data entry. The Packaging Operator will perform visual inspections, reject nonconforming parts, and maintain a clean and organized work area. The successful candidate will work closely with other team members and follow established procedures to ensure product quality and compliance.

 

Essential Functions and Responsibilities:

  • Inspect, weigh, and package extremely small thin parts.
  • Perform visual inspections on parts prior to packing and reject nonconforming parts following established procedures.
  • Perform screening as required.
  • Package products according to customer requirements as shown on the picklist and apply labels as instructed to packages.
  • Accurately collect and input data into the computer system.
  • Maintain cleanliness of work area and assigned equipment.
  • Follow all safety guidelines and wear proper PPE when in the manufacturing area.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ned by supervisor and/or management.

 

Knowledge / Skills / Abilities Required:

  • Safety conscious with excellent verbal and written communication skills and good mathematical aptitude.
  • Ability to grasp and handle products ranging from extremely small to large.
  • Basic computer skills required; must be able to make computer transactions into the ERP system.
  • Must be able to perform duties without external distractions, such as mobile phones and personal electronic devices.
  • Ability to use a microscope, magnifying lens, tweezers, and other hand tools as assigned.
  • Must be able to lift up to 25 pounds and anything heavier with assistance or hand tools.

 

Education, Experience, and Training:

  • High School Diploma or GED required.
